WebApr 22, 2024 · Bubble charts show the data in the form of a circle. The values of the variables are represented by the x-axis and y-axis. The size of the circle represents the measure of the variables. For Instance: In the below bubble chart, you can observe that on X-axis, the community is measured, and quality is measured on Y-axis. WebBubble charts use the size and coloring of bubbles to show multiple dimensions and measures. Use a bubble chart to illustrate the relationship between two columns of numerical data in your spreadsheet. A third numerical column represents the size of each bubble in the chart. WebAug 10, 2024 · Common use cases include (but are not limited to) the following: Competitive analyses Customer satisfaction ratings Revenue projections Risk assessment … WebUse a bubble chart to visualize multiple series data in three dimensions. Bubble position represents two dimensions of the data series. Bubble size represents the third dimension.
